VACUUM PUMP AND ELECTROMAGNET UNIT USED FOR VACUUM PUMP
An electromagnet unit in which influence of a noise on a displacement sensor is suppressed and which can be installed in a space-saving manner and a vacuum pump including the electromagnet unit are provided. An electromagnet unit includes a radial electromagnet which controls a shaft to a predetermined position, a radial sensor which detects a position of the shaft, and a printed board interposed between the radial electromagnet and the radial sensor and on which a wiring pattern for sensor connecting coils of the corresponding two radial sensors to each other and a wiring pattern connecting coils of the corresponding two radial electromagnets to each other are provided. The wiring pattern for sensor and the wiring pattern for electromagnet are disposed so as not to overlap when seen from the axial direction.
Method for calibrating gap sensor
Disclosed is a method for calibrating at least one gap sensor, the at least one gap sensor being provided on a magnetic bearing supporting a floating body in a non-contact manner by an electromagnetic force, the at least one gap sensor being configured to detect a gap between the floating body and a reference object that serves as a positional reference for position control of the floating body. The method includes: constructing a transformation formula for transforming an output of the at least one gap sensor into the gap using three or more constraints that are set as conditions for associating the gap with the output of the at least one gap sensor.
A MAGNETIC ACTUATOR FOR A MAGNETIC SUSPENSION SYSTEM
A magnetic actuator for a magnetic suspension system includes a core section having an annular yoke and radially directed teeth joining the yoke. The magnetic actuator includes coils surrounding the teeth and a mechanical structure having a first section and a second section. The first section is attached to the yoke and conducts magnetic flux axially. The second section joins the first section and conducts the magnetic flux radially in a direction opposite to a direction of the magnetic flux in the teeth. The magnetic actuator includes a mechanical safety bearing that is between the second section and the teeth. Thus, the safety bearing is in a room surrounded by a magnetic flux circulation path. Therefore, the safety bearing does not increase an axial length of the magnetic suspension system.
DISPLACEMENT DETECTION CIRCUIT OF MAGLEV ROTOR SYSTEM AND DISPLACEMENT SELF-SENSING SYSTEM THEREOF
The present disclosure provides a displacement detection circuit of a maglev rotor system and a displacement self-sensing system thereof. The displacement detection circuit comprises a current sampling circuit (10) configured to collect a current flowing through a corresponding coil (4); coils (4), which are coils (4) distributed in series in the maglev rotor system; Hall sensors (20), the Hall sensors (20) being arranged in an upper auxiliary air gap (8) and a lower auxiliary air gap (8) of the maglev rotor system, and sensing surfaces of the Hall sensors (20) being perpendicular to magnetic field directions in the corresponding auxiliary air gaps (8); a Hall signal processing circuit (30) connected to the Hall sensors (20) and configured to differentiate a Hall sensing signal corresponding to the upper auxiliary air gap (8) and a Hall sensing signal corresponding to the lower auxiliary air gap (8); and a displacement signal resolving circuit (40) connected to the current sampling circuit (10) and the Hall signal processing circuit (30) respectively and configured to acquire a displacement of a rotor in the maglev rotor system according to the current and a differentiation result. By using the detection circuit and the displacement self-sensing system thereof, the axial size of the rotor is reduced, such that detection and control are coplanar, and high precision and simple design are realized.
